During descent the controller mantains a cabin rate to equal cabin pressure to landing field pressure with a maximum descent rate of?
750ft/min
“Hot air fault” light illuminates on the air conditioning panel
The hot air pressure regulator valve closes and the trim air valve closes automatically
In normal flight, the avionics ventilation system controls the temperature of the cooling air by?
Passing air through a skin heat exchanger
Temperature regulation is automatic and controlled by?
One zone controller and two packs controller (MSN 2472 older)
Two ACSC (Air conditioning system controllers) MSN 2736 New
Optimized temperature regulation
The system optimizes the temperature acting on the trim air valves
The Packs Ram air inlet flaps close during T/O and LDG to avoid ingestion of foreing matter

“HOT AIR” pressure regulator valve failed open. Is there any effect?
No effect
BLEED AIR supplied from the APU (APU BLEED VALVE OPEN), The pack flow is automatically selected in which mode?
High, normal, low…?
High
TRIM AIR valve adjust temperature by?
-Adding hot air
-Adding cold fresh air
-Modulating the pack flow control valve
-Mixing recirculated cabin air
Adding HOT AIR
The “HOT AIR” pressure regulating valve:
Regulates the pressure of hot air tapped upstream of the packs
PACK FLOW CONTROL VALVE its —– operated and —— controlled
Pneumatically operated
Electrically controlled
The zone temperature selectors are located in?
Cockpit in the overhead panel
Engine bleed press. demand, when the cooling demand in one zone cannot be satisfied, what happens with the idle?
Minimum idle is increased automatically
TRIM AIR valves are controlled by?
Zone controller or the ACSC on MSN higher than 2736
The MIXER UNIT is connected to?
Packs, recirculated cabin air, emergency ram air inlet and LP ground inlets
Should the ECAM display “AIR COND CTL 1(2) - A (B) FAULT in models MSN’ higher than 2736?
What does it mean?
Lane A(B) of ACSC 1(2) fails.
Should the ECAM display on ground “VENT AVNCS SYS FAULT”
Flight Crew should perform the ECAM actions and, previous to the STATUS review, refer to QRH to perform the AEVC System Reset
The PACK FLOW control valce closes AUTOMATICALLY in case of:
Pack overheat in ground, engine start or operation of the fire or ditching push button.
If pack controller fails (PRIMARY AND SECONDARY CHANNEL), the OUTLET PACK temperature is pneumatically regulated at what temperature?
Between 5ºC and 30ºC in a max. of 6 min.
What statements about the Air Conditioning System Controllers (ACSC) are correct?
-ACSC 1 regulates cockpit temp, ACSC 2 regulates the temp. of the 2 cabin zones
-Each ACSC has 2 lanes.
-1 Lane failure of 1 ACSC has no effect.
All are CORRECT
APU BLEED AIR, the zone controller or the ACSC sends a demand signal to increase the APU flow when a zone temperature cannot be satisfied. Where is this signal sent to?
APU ECB (electronic control box)
The DITCHING switch when selected sends a closure signal to?
-Outflow valve
-Emergency RAM air inlet, the avionics inlet and extract valves
-Pack flow control valves.
ALL CORRECT
In flight, if cabin pressure controller CPC n.1 fails?
It transfers auto to CPC n.2
